Türkiye Earthquakes: New Images of Collapsed Building Emerged

The aftermath of the devastating earthquakes centered in Kahramanmaraş on February 6 in Türkiye continues to unfold, with newly revealed images capturing the moment when ‘Sahil’ apartment building in Iskenderun district, Hatay, collapsed. The building, consisting of two 6-floor blocks, tragically claimed the lives of 65 people. The images showcase the severity of the disaster, leaving only debris where the building once stood.

Survivor Arzu Yavuz recounts the harrowing experience, stating that Sahil and Eda apartment buildings collapsed within the first 10 seconds of the earthquake, resulting in brutal fatalities. She hopes such a tragedy will never befall anyone else and estimates that only one person survived. Another eyewitness, tradesman Çağrı Gürpınar, notes that the two buildings crumbled in the first 15 seconds of the earthquake, emphasizing their age as a factor in their inability to withstand the quake’s intensity. The death toll is estimated to be between 60 and 80, with only 4 or 5 survivors pulled from the apartment rubble.

Turkish Businessman Restores First Car After 41 Years

Tanju Acar, head of the Düzce Chamber of Commerce and Industry Assembly, tracked down his first car “Maviş,” (blue eyed) which he sold 41 years ago, in a scrap yard in Konya. After seven months of meticulous restoration, he gifted it to his 5-year-old grandson.

Acar said the car carries deep sentimental value and promised to recreate a photo taken with his schoolmate Talat, now battling cancer, in the same spot 41 years later. Restorer Ruhi Ozan described the project as “a labor of love,” turning the once-wrecked vehicle back into its original form.
